https://github.com/sirver/ultisnips <-已编辑
我正在使用ultisnips和我的rails代码片段,只有当我有ruby.rails文件类型时才能工作。
:set filetype=ruby.rails
但是我没有rails语法。因为语法适用于:set filetype=ruby
如何设置文件类型或正确识别语法?
编辑:报告给ultisnips launchpad:https://bugs.launchpad.net/ultisnips/+bug/946549
发布于 2012-03-06 20:35:11
我在理解这个问题上有些困难。如果您想要ruby文件类型rails代码片段,为什么不创建一个文件~/.vim/UltiSnips/ruby.snippets并添加一行
extends rails或者您在将文件类型设置为ruby.rails时遇到了问题?如果是这样,创建一个新文件~/.vim/ftdetect/rails.vim (名称无关紧要)。
autocmd BufNewFile,BufRead *.rails set ft=ruby.rails快速编辑:现在还有UltiSnipsAddFiletypes (还没有在2.1中,将在2.2中,它已经在存储库中)。您还可以编辑~/.vim/ftplugin/rails.vim并添加
UltiSnipsAddFiletypes rails.rubyhttps://stackoverflow.com/questions/9557643
复制相似问题